Uploaded image for project: 'PUBLIC - Liferay Social Office Community Edition'
  1. PUBLIC - Liferay Social Office Community Edition
  2. SOS-1573

Private restricted sites are not show properly in Sites portlet when a regular user view it.

    Details

    • Fix Priority:
      4

      Description

      Private restricted sites are not show properly in Sites portlet when a regular user view it.

      1. Add Private Restricted site
      2. Add user
      3. Sign in as User

      System fails to list Private Restricted site properly

      1. Click Site Directory

      System fails to list Private Restricted site properly

      Browser Debugger
      AUI().use("aui-base","aui-dialog","aui-io-plugin",function(a){Liferay.namespace("Tasks");Liferay.Tasks={init:function(c){var b=this;b._setupFilter();b._setupTagsPopup();b._setupProgressBar();b._currentTab=c.currentTab;b._taskListURL=c.taskListURL},clearFilters:function(){var b=this;a.all(".tasks-portlet .asset-tag-filter .asset-tag.selected").toggle("selected");var d=a.one(".tasks-portlet .group-filter select");if(d){d.set("value",0)}var c=a.one('.tasks-portlet input[name="all-tasks"]').get("checked");b.updateTaskList(null,c)},closePopup:function(){var b=this;b.getPopup().hide()},displayPopup:function(d,e){var b=this;var f=a.getBody().get("viewportRegion");var c=b.getPopup();c.show();c.set("title",e);c.io.set("uri",d);c.io.start()},getPopup:function(){var b=this;if(!b._popup){b._popup=new a.Dialog({align:{node:null,points:["tc","tc"]},constrain2view:true,cssClass:"tasks-dialog",modal:true,resizable:false,width:600}).plug(a.Plugin.IO,{autoLoad:false}).render()}b._popup.io.set("form",null);b._popup.io.set("uri",null);return b._popup},openTask:function(b){this.displayPopup(b,"Tasks")},toggleCommentForm:function(){var d=a.one(".tasks-dialog .add-comment");var c=d.one(".control");var b=d.one(".form");b.toggle();c.toggle()},toggleTasksFilter:function(){a.one(".tasks-portlet .filter-wrapper").toggle()},updateTaskList:function(c,d){var b=this;b._taskList=a.one(".tasks-portlet .list-wrapper");if(!b._taskList.io){b._taskList.plug(a.Plugin.IO,{autoLoad:false})}if(!c){c=b._taskListURL;var e={assetTagIds:b._getAssetTagIds(),groupId:b._getGroupId(),tabs1:b._currentTab,tabs2:d?"all":"open"};b._taskList.io.set("data",e)}b._taskList.io.set("uri",c);b._taskList.io.start()},_getAssetTagIds:function(){var b=[];a.all(".tasks-portlet .asset-tag-filter .asset-tag.selected").each(function(c,d,e){b.push(c.attr("data-assetTagId"))});return b.join(",")},_getGroupId:function(){var b=a.one(".tasks-portlet .group-filter select");if(!b){return 0}return b.get("value")},_setupFilter:function(){var b=this;a.one(".tasks-portlet .asset-tag-filter").delegate("click",function(e){var c=e.currentTarget;c.toggleClass("selected");var d=a.one('.tasks-portlet input[name="all-tasks"]').get("checked");b.updateTaskList(null,d)},".asset-tag");a.all(".tasks-portlet .group-filter select").on("change",function(d){var c=a.one('.tasks-portlet input[name="all-tasks"]').get("checked");b.updateTaskList(null,c)})},_setupTagsPopup:function(){var b=a.one(".tasks-portlet");b.delegate("mouseover",function(c){c.currentTarget.one(".tags").show()},".tags-wrapper");b.delegate("mouseout",function(c){c.currentTarget.one(".tags").hide()},".tags-wrapper")},_setupProgressBar:function(){var b=this;var c=a.one(".tasks-portlet .list-wrapper");c.delegate("mouseover",function(d){d=d.currentTarget;d.one(".current").hide();d.one(".progress-picker").show()},".progress-wrapper");c.delegate("mouseout",function(d){d=d.currentTarget;d.one(".current").show();d.one(".progress-picker").hide()},".progress-wrapper");c.delegate("mouseover",function(e){e=e.currentTarget;var f=e.getAttribute("class");var g=f.substring(f.indexOf("progress-")+9);var d=e.ancestor(".progress-wrapper");d.one(".new-progress").setStyle("width",g+"%");d.one(".progress-indicator").set("text",g+"% Complete")},".progress-selector a");c.delegate("click",function(e){e.halt();var d=e.currentTarget.getAttribute("href");b.updateTaskList(d)},".progress-selector a")}}});
      

        Activity

        Hide
        benjamin.yeh Benjamin Yeh (Inactive) added a comment -

        Passed following steps in description:

        Fixed on:
        Tomcat 7.0.34 + MySQL 5.5. 6.1.20 EE GA2
        SO Plugins 6.1.x EE GIT ID: ae4afffa58f8509c04ad64de1f978f6daaa8b42d.

        Show
        benjamin.yeh Benjamin Yeh (Inactive) added a comment - Passed following steps in description: Fixed on: Tomcat 7.0.34 + MySQL 5.5. 6.1.20 EE GA2 SO Plugins 6.1.x EE GIT ID: ae4afffa58f8509c04ad64de1f978f6daaa8b42d.
        Hide
        mandy.zia mandy.zia added a comment -

        Fixed on:
        Tomcat 7 + MySQL 5. Portal 6.1.1 CE GA2.
        Plugins 6.1.x CE GIT ID: 6852c2ab7a2e61b395f07562bed276fa1f77b3b5.

        Show
        mandy.zia mandy.zia added a comment - Fixed on: Tomcat 7 + MySQL 5. Portal 6.1.1 CE GA2. Plugins 6.1.x CE GIT ID: 6852c2ab7a2e61b395f07562bed276fa1f77b3b5.

          People

          • Assignee:
            benjamin.yeh Benjamin Yeh (Inactive)
            Reporter:
            benjamin.yeh Benjamin Yeh (Inactive)
            Participants of an Issue:
          •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:
              Days since last comment:
              3 years, 15 weeks, 4 days ago

              Development

                Subcomponents